Abstract

Genomic medicine refers to genomics and bioinformatics in the context of clinical care and diagnostics. Due to the generic and technology-based nature of the field, genomic medicine relates to a broad variety of medical specialities. Genomic medicine is fuelled by the rapid development of next generation sequencing technologies, which allow rapid sequencing of a complete human genome. In this way genomic data have become part of the early stages of the diagnostic workup. This review provides a brief description of the current status and perspectives of genomic medicine.
